  • A taxonomic study on the Eucyclops serrulatus species group has been accomplished as one of the serial researches on the freshwater cyclopoid copepods in Korea. As a result, the 'Eucyclops serrulatus', hitherto known from Korea through many reports and papers, turns out to be a species complex of six sibling species: E. serrulatus (Fischer), E. roseus Ishida, E speratus (Lilljeborg), E. pacificus Ishida, E. ohtakai Ishida, and I tsushimensis Ishida Taxonomic accounts on their detailed interspecific discrepancies and intraspecific variabilities are presented. A key to the Eucyclops serrulatus group from the Far East is also provided.

  • 우리는 대표적인 디지털 플랫폼인 온라인 음식 주문 배달 산업을 대상으로 디지털 경제의 긴꼬리 효과를 계량화한다. 특히, 코로나19 시기를 거치면서 음식배달플랫폼 입점으로 인한 긴꼬리 효과의 변화 양상을 고찰한다. 배달의민족에 입점한 음식점 15,000곳을 무작위로 선별하고 이들 매장의 2019년부터 2021년까지 전체 주문 정보를 취합(aggregation)하여 선형로그변환 후 기울기를 추정하여 디지털 경제의 긴꼬리 효과를 실증 분석하였다. 2019년부터 2021년까지 관찰기간 동안 음식 배달 플랫폼 활용 음식점 주비모수 분포의 긴꼬리 효과는 강건하게 관찰되었다. 이는 코로나19 이후 음식배달 플랫폼을 통한 음식점의 디지털 전환이 틈새시장 확장에 일정 부분 기여하였음을 의미한다. 또한, 긴꼬리 효과는 객단가가 높을수록 매출액 상위 집단일수록 더 커지는 반면, 비황금 시간대 매출비중이 높은 경우 긴꼬리 효과가 통계적으로 유의하게 증가하지 않았다. 이 결과는 피자, 족발 등 단가가 높고 비교적 배달서비스가 활발한 카테고리에서 음식 주문 및 배달 산업의 디지털 전환 효과가 증가한다는 업계 실무자들의 관찰과 부합한다. 타 업종에서도 상대적으로 경쟁이 치열한 시장 구분에서 디지털 경제의 긴꼬리 효과가 보다 강건하게 관찰될 것이라고 여겨진다. 음식점 간 경쟁강도가 상대적으로 약한 비황금시간대 매출비중이 긴꼬리 효과에 통계학적으로 유의한 영향을 주지 않는다는 실증결과 또한 동일한 함의가 있다.

  • The paper examines several classes of probability distributions with heavy tails. An (asymptotic) expression for tail probability needs to be known to understand which class a given probability distribution belongs to. It is usually not easy to get expressions for tail probabilities since most absolutely continuous probability distributions are specified by probability density functions and not by distribution functions. The paper proposes a method to obtain asymptotic expressions for tail probabilities using only probability density functions. Some examples are given to illustrate the proposed method.

  • Although the tail vessels are frequently used for serial blood sampling in rat, the definition of its vasculature remains in dispute. Herein, we investigated the number of blood vessels in Sprague-Dawley rat tail using angiographic and histological methods. Our results showed rat tail has one dorsal vein, two lateral veins, one ventral artery and one ventral vein. In the conclusion, when deciding which site is best for collecting blood, it is critical to consider the structure and features of the blood vessels to be used. This study will also be helpful for investigators to understand the structure of blood vessels in rat tail.

  • Asplenium yoshinagae (Aspleniaceae), previously known only from Japan, southwest China to Himalaya, was found in Gageo-do, Heuksan-myeon, Sinan-gun, Jeollanam-do. This species is similar to A. trichomonas, A. tripteropus, A. boreale, A. normale and A. oligophlebium by having gemmae and auricle of pinna, and distinguished from the latters by distinct stipe length, stalk of pinna, acute apex of pinna, length of indusium and shape of sorus. The Local name, Ga-geo-kko-ri-go-sa-ri, was newly given considering the locality. To reveal the interspecific relationships within the genus Asplenium in Korea, cladistic analysis was performed for 22 taxa of Asplenium as ingroup and 2 taxa of Diplazium as outgroup from Korea based on 20 morphological characters. As the results, the genus Asplenium seperated strongly from outgroup, and divided into 4 clades. Asplenium yoshinagae belong to the third clade. A. hondoense N. Murtakami & S. I. Hatanaka, which contained in the second clade, had treated as Hymenasplenium, but this results supported that this taxon may be contained in Asplenium, and also, Asplenium ruprechtii, not in Comptosorus. The morphological characters and illustrations of the species are provided together with photographs of habitat.

  • To verify hybridity of Asplenium castaneo-viride, external morphology, spore morphology, anatomy and chromosomes of the species and of the two presumed parental species, A. incisum and A. ruprechtii, were examined. A. castaneo-viride usually had 1-pinnately divided frond. However, some individuals had almost simple fronds with pinnatisect basal parts similar to A. ruprechtii, while others had fronds similar to A. incisum in having oblanceolate blades and basal pinnae with triangular, 2-3 lobed apices. On the surface of the spores, sculpturing consisted of folds that were usually prominent; forming long wings, and irregular or incomplete reticulation. However, reticulation patterns varied among species. A. castaneo-viride showed a wide range of variation from sparse to dense patterns, whereas A. incisum showed only from sparse to intermediate patterns. A. ruprechtii showed from intermediate to dense patterns. The spore size of A. castaneo-viride was $54.63{\mu}m$, larger than other two species ($47.81{\mu}m$ in A. incisum and $44.22{\mu}m$ in A. ruprechtii). The level of undulation of epidermal cell wall was also different. A. incisum had the most shallowly undulated wall, and A. castaneo-viride had a pattern intermediate between the two presumed parental species. This same patterns was recognized in the density of stomata. The density of $45.91/mm^2$ in A. castaneo-viride was intermediate between the two presumed parental species ($67.00/mm^2$ in A. incisum, and $37.86/mm^2$ in A. ruprechtii). Chromosome number was constant (2x =2n = 72) as in A. incisum and A. ruprechtii. However, A. castaneo-viride showed a different ploidy level. The populations of Mt. Mai (Jeonbuk province) and Mt. Duryun (Jeonnam province) were diploid (2n = 72) which is a new record for this taxon, whereas the population of Mt. Buram (Seoul) was tetraploid (2n = 144). Conclusively, A. castaneo-viride was revealed to be a hybrid of A. ruprechtii and A. incisum based on evidence involving leaves, spores, epidermal cells, stomata and chromosome number.

  • A single specimen (700 mm in disc length) of Plesiobatis daviesi, belonging to the family Plesiobatididae, was firstly collected in the north-eastern coastal waters of Jejudo Island, Korea by using a bottom trawl on 24 October 2010. This species was characterized by having five pairs of gill openings, tail with one to three large spines, long snout length, long caudal fin, and pleated margin of nasal curtain. It is morphologically similar to Urolophus aurantiacus, but the former is distinguished from the latter by having longer caudal fin and snout length. We add P. daviesi to the Korean fish fauna and suggest the new Korean names, "Gin-kko-ri-huin-ga-o-ri-gwa", "Gin-kko-ri-huin-ga-o-ri-sok" and "Gin-kko-ri-huin-ga-o-ri" for the family, genus and species, respectively.

  • We surveyed 281 sites of tropical plants and 666 sites of fruit plants for three years (2015~2017) on Pseudococcus longispinus and Pseudococcus orchidicola which have not been surveyed domestically. In tropical plants, P. longispinus were found at 34 sites, while P. orchidicola were found at 87 sites. However, both species were not found in fruit plants. The developmental characteristics of P. longispinus and P. orchidicola were investigated under various temperatures. The female nymph of P. longispinus did not develop at $14^{\circ}C$ and the developmental period was the longest at $16^{\circ}C$ for 361.4 days and the shortest at $32^{\circ}C$ for 39.0 days. The longevity of female adult of P. longispinus was the shortest at $28^{\circ}C$ as 71.7 days. The number of offspring was highest at 177.7 at $32^{\circ}C$. The female nymph of P. orchidicola did not develop at $12^{\circ}C$. However, the developmental period was the longest at $14^{\circ}C$ for 184.9 days and the shortest at $28^{\circ}C$ for 21.5 days. The longevity of female adult of P. orchidicola was the shortest at 51.5 days at $28^{\circ}C$. The number of offspring was highest at 143.8 at $28^{\circ}C$. The net reproductive rate ($R_0$) and intrinsic rate of increase ($r_m$) of P. longispinus were 162.3 and 0.127 at $32^{\circ}C$, respectively. The $R_0$ and $r_m$ of P. orchidicola were 98.3 and 0.139 at $28^{\circ}C$, respectively. These results suggest that the optimum temperature of P. longispinus and P. orchidicola was $32^{\circ}C$ and $28^{\circ}C$, respectively. Therefore, we guess that they can never be able to survive the winter of Korea.

  • Increasing the detection probability of underwater targets necessitates securing the towing stability of the active towed SONAR. In this paper, to confirm the effects of tail wing fin on towing attitude and towing stability, two scale model experiments and one sea trials were conducted and the results were analyzed. The scale model tests measured the towing behavior of each of the tail fin shapes according to towing speed in a towing tank. The shape of the tail fin used in the scale model test was tested with an I-type tail fine and four Y-type tail fins, totaling five tail fins of the two kinds. The first scale model test confirmed that the Y-type tail fin was superior to the I-type tail fin in towing attitude and towing stability. The second scale model test confirmed the characteristics of the vertical tail fin height increase and the lower horizontal tail fin inclination angle application shape based on the Y-type tail fin. The shape of the application of the lower horizontal tail fin inclination angle showed the best performance. In order to verify the results of the scale model test, a full size model was constructed, sea trials were performed, and the towing attitude was measured. The results were similar to those of the scale model test.

  • With the development of the aviation industry, aircraft painting design also plays the role of transmitting the national image while conveying the individual image of the airline. The recognition and recognition of the national image can be obtained by building a national brand. As a result, more and more companies are using the national brand image of their own country or other countries to add value to the company. Objective: To better reflect the national brand recognition for the design of the tail fin in the future aircraft painting design. This paper mainly studies the correlation between the tail graphic elements of aircraft painting design and national brand recognition based on the tail graphics of the three major airline alliance members. Based on the prior research, the relevant hypotheses were proposed and the questionnaire was designed. Secondly, a questionnaire survey was conducted on the passengers using the aircraft, and the correlation analysis was performed on the data by the SPSS regression analysis method. Conclusion: Data analysis has a strong correlation.
